It's 1996. An Algerian couple, Aya and Moncef, have been living in the south of France for forty years. Both participated actively in the Algerian war independence under the command of the charismatic Amin, the local leader of the revolutionary F.L.N. Now, Amin is coming to visit them. Aya's memory is jarred by long-faded images. The last time Amin came to her home, it was in 1965 to take refuge from the police. Aya was only 22 years old, but already the mother of two children. A secret romance, brief but intense, was born between Aya and Amin, which broke all laws, exposing them to a sure death if caught. Yet they persisted. Amin promised to take Aya to Algeria after the war and make big plans for their future and for their country. Amin's visit forces everyone to take a clear look at their choices and responsibilities.
